
Social Golf Association's Scramble Tournament
Tuesday, September 10, 2024
09:00AM - Tuesday, September 10, 2024 03:00PM
2600 Benning Road Northeast • Langston Golf Course & Driving Range • Washington • DC
Summary
Join the Social Golf Association for our Inaugural Scramble Golf Tournament during the Congressional Black Caucus Foundation's Annual Legislative Conference Week!
Celebrate the rich legacy of Black golf at the Historic Langston Golf Course with special guests Congressman Troy Carter (LA-02), and former NBA professional DJ Augustin.
Enjoy a fun scramble format, with closest-to-the-pin and longest drive competitions. Proceeds will support the Congressional Black Caucus Foundation's mission to advance the global Black community. In partnership with First Tee of Greater Washington, DC, we aim to promote youth development and community engagement through golf and will be accepting golf items to donate their cause.
Don't miss this memorable day of golf, celebrating Black excellence and cultural heritage. Join us for a fantastic event filled with fun, competition, and community spirit!

About The Historic Langston Golf Course
Langston Golf Course is a historic landmark and the first golf course in the city built specifically for Black Americans. Named after John Mercer Langston – the first Black Virginian elected to Congress – the course opened in 1939 and quickly became a cornerstone for the Black golfing community.
Over the years, Langston has hosted numerous celebrities and trailblazers, including Joe Louis and Muhammad Ali – but none with a greater influence than Lee Elder. Lee Elder was the first Black golfer invited to compete in the Masters he also managed Langston Golf Course, contributing significantly to its development and preservation.
Langston is the birthplace of the Royal Golf (Men) and the Wake-Robin (Women) Golf Clubs, the oldest Black golf clubs in the country. Together, the clubs lobbied the federal government to desegregate the city's public golf courses. In 1938, they petitioned Secretary of the Interior Harold Ickes for access to public courses funded by their federal taxes. Instead, Ickes permitted the construction of a golf course for Black people on an abandoned trash site, leading to Langston's creation as a nine-hole golf course. Both clubs continued to fight for the desegregation of all public golf courses, resulting in Ickes issuing a desegregation order at the city's federal courses in 1941.
